1.What makes inflatable Halloween decorations different from animatronics?

Inflatables create a big visual impact with bright lights and bold designs. Animatronics, on the other hand, use sound, movement, and glowing effects for interactive scares. Together, they serve very different purposes in a display.

2. Are ground-level props like crawling zombies more effective than standing figures?

Ground props work best for surprise scares because visitors don’t expect movement near their feet. Standing figures are more visible and act as main attention-grabbers. Using both adds balance to your Halloween setup.

3. Why are witches and reapers among the most popular Halloween decorations?

Witches and reapers are iconic symbols of Halloween, instantly recognized by all ages. They embody themes of magic, mystery, and fear, making them versatile in both family-friendly and scary displays.

4. Can I combine multiple types of decorations in one display?

Yes, mixing inflatables, animatronics, and hanging props creates layers of depth and variety. This combination keeps the display exciting and ensures every part of the space has something unique to offer.

5. Which Halloween decoration type is best for family-friendly events?

Inflatables like pumpkins, black cats, and cheerful ghosts are the safest choice. They add festive atmosphere without being too frightening, making them ideal for children and community gatherings.
